As a Registered Manager, you will need to hold or be actively working towards your Level 5 Diploma in Residential Care and be
prepared to pass your fit-persons interview with Ofsted to secure the home registration. We are committed to supporting you
through this process, especially if this is your first time registering.

Yn gyffredinol, bydd cyflogwr Hyderus o ran Anabledd yn cynnig cyfweliad i unrhyw ymgeisydd sy'n datgan eu bod yn anabl ac yn bodloni'r meini prawf lleiaf ar gyfer y swydd fel y diffinnir gan y cyflogwr. Mae'n bwysig nodi, mewn rhai sefyllfaoedd recriwtio fel nifer fawr o ymgeiswyr, cyfnod tymhorol ac amseroedd prysur iawn, efallai y bydd y cyflogwr am gyfyngu ar y niferoedd cyffredinol o gyfweliadau a gynigir i bobl anabl a phobl nad ydynt yn anabl.
